The French foreign ministry will summon the Russian ambassador to condemn the killing of two French humanitarian workers in Ukraine and protest the surge of anti-French disinformation. This follows Russia's claim that it killed dozens of 'French mercenaries' in a strike in northeastern Ukraine, which Paris has denied. Tensions between the two countries have grown, with France also planning to denounce reinforced disinformation targeting them. President Emmanuel Macron is expected to visit Kyiv later this month, a trip that France believes could be the target of further disinformation attacks.
